Nicole Lowder

 

Nicole is our manager here at Clemmons Gymnastics.

She is head coach of all our Carolina Elite cheerleading squads 

as well as working with all gymnastics levels and ages, from our

Parent-n-Tot program, to basic tumbling classes, all the way

to the Advanced Intermediate level. She started gymnastics at

Clemmons Gymnastics at the age of 5, and began cheering

for their Clemmons All-Stars at age 7. She did competitive

cheerleading for 10 years, in which her squad won over

20 National Titles as well as walking away with 1st place

at the 2005 World Championship. In April of 2009,

Nicole competed on an Open Coed International

team at the USASF World Championships and

placed 7th out of 47 teams from around the world. Nicole

has been teaching here for 7 years.

Brittany

 

Brittany is our Head Gymnastics Coach. She teaches all levels,

 ranging from Parent-Tot to the AB2 and Intermediate levels.

She has 10 years of gymnastics experience. She participated

in competitive gymnastics, during which time she placed

 1st in State Prep-Optional and 2nd place in levels 6 and 7.

 She competed up to level 9 and is also a sergeant in the

Army National Guard. This is Brittany's first year with us.

Gaylynn
 
Gaylynn is our Pre-School Director. She has worked
with pre-school children for 22 years and has 15
years of gymnastics experience, as well as having
taught with us for 16 years.
 
 
 

Jay

 

Jay is our Strength and Conditioning Specialist. He has been

strength training for over 20 years and has been working

with athletes on their strength, speed and athletic abilities

for over 18 years. He is a member of the National Strength

and Conditioning Association; a registered Black Belt

in TKDO and a Mixed Martial Artist. Jay has worked with

athletes of all levels from Professional to seven year olds

just starting out. He has experience working with athletes

in several sports including but not limited to: football,

baseball, basketball, triathlons, gymnastics, swimming,

track and field, martial arts, lacrosse, volleyball, wrestling,

cheerleading and many more.

 

Jay is a published author for several strength and

conditioning articles and continues to work with

athletes of all age groups and colleges on an

individual basis including University of Tampa,

Georgia Tech, NC State and several others. 

 

 

 

Nick

 

Nick is a graduate of Wake Forest University, where

he was a cheerleader all 4 years. He is now helping

in our Cheerleading Program and Tumbling Classes.

 He has 2 years of experience working with children,

 and has worked with cheerleaders for 2 years.

This is Nick's second year with us.

Mary

 

Mary is the director of our Day Camp/After-School

Care program. She is also currently a 3 year old

preschool teacher at Clemmons Moravian

Preschool, where she has taught for 8 years.

In addition, she has a Bachelor of Arts degree

from UNCC, certification in First Aid and CPR.

Volunteer work included religious education

of third graders and a Girl Scout Leader for 10

years. She has experience working with special

needs and autistic children.
